## Deploying the Gatewick Proctor Queue

Deploys are pretty painless: push to main, wait for the pipeline, then watch the queue drain dashboard for five minutes. If candidates pile up mid-exam, roll back first and ask questions later — the queue replays safely. Everything the workers care about lives in one config block, shown here for reference.

settings of bafof-yagef:
JOROX_PIN=8740
JOROX_TENANT=pelox
JOROX_METRICS_HOST=metrics.jorox.qorvelworks.internal
JOROX_SEAL=seal_c78f63c1
JOROX_STANDBY_TEAM=norax

## Changelog — Ticktrace 1.9

### Renamed: DRIFT_API_TOKEN
During the cron drift investigation we found plugins confusing this variable with the metrics token, so it has been renamed to indicate it authorizes drift-report uploads specifically. Plugin authors must read the new name from 1.9 onward; the old name is ignored without warning. Sample env files in the SDK are updated. In your deployment env file, the drift-report upload secret is set on the next line.

env line for fawef-taguf: VAULT_KEY13=a9695905a9a90

# Onboarding: Monthly Partitioning (Kestrelbase)

Event tables in Kestrelbase are partitioned by calendar month. Partitions are pre-created two months ahead by the partman job. If inserts fail near month boundaries, check that job first. Dropping partitions older than 13 months is automated — never do it manually. Partman API calls authenticate with the key below.

gateway credential: kto23_dolYgAScEh2TaPOlStqOl98

Ticket: Kiosk watchdog sign-off needed before Friday's push. The Pavillo kiosk app's watchdog was restarting the UI every ~40 minutes due to a false-positive heartbeat timeout. We bumped the timeout from 10s to 30s and added a jittered retry, tested on six kiosks at the Marwick Mall pilot — zero spurious restarts over 48 hours. Release manager, we just need your blessing to include this in 4.2.1. Before merging, please get sign-off from the owner listed below.

account owner for bawip-tahag: Raleth Quenok